Welcome to the desert of the real was presented as a multimedia theatre piece at the 2010 Zurich Theatre Festival in Switzerland, with seven performances in Zurich, Geneva and Basel, and as a five-band HD video installation at the 11th Sharjah Biennale in 2013. The work is inspired by the book of the same name by Gönczek – a line from the 1999 film ‘B&B’ that echoes Balduria’s book ‘Imagery and Simulation’. The story begins with the experiences of a 16-year-old boy who moves with his family from rural China to the city. He struggles with his own identity in the city crowd and gradually escapes into the virtual reality of online games until he can no longer distinguish between fantasy and real life. Interspersed are the stories of four other people with different identities.
